Google Employee, John Burke Invests In Teachit.co.uk

Amit Chowdhry | Monday October 13, 2008 | 1,488 views| Add a Comment
Categorized under


Teachit.co.uk is a U.K.-based education website that is about 9 years old.  John Burke, Managing Director of Industry Development and Marketing at Google Inc. (NASDAQ:GOOG) has made an undisclosed investment in Teachit according to paidContent

“There were a number of other private investors, who are not taking board positions,” stated Garry Pratt, MD of Teachit.  “The founders still control over 80 percent of the company. John’s investment is private and he is staying on at his position with Google.”  Teachit plans to use the funding to introduce their site to the U.S. and markets of other countries.
